GSOAP wsdl2h ssl构建错误

时间:2016-05-17 11:02:21

标签: gsoap

我尝试使用gsoap生成.h文件,但我得到错误,说我必须下载wsdl文件并再次运行,因为它包含ssl访问权限。

好的 - 我下载并重新执行命令但仍然出现同样的错误。

我该如何解决呢?

enter image description here

WSDL Link

1 个答案:

答案 0 :(得分:1)

您有两种选择:

  1. 使用浏览器下载.wsdl文件,并下载.wsdl文件导入的所有.xsd文件。然后在这些本地文件上运行wsdl2h,从.xsd文件开始。如果这不起作用,那么更改所有URI以引用本地文件(只需.xsd文件名)。
  2. 使用cd gsoap/wsdl; make secure重建wsdl2h以启用HTTPS的SSL支持。
  3. 选项#2不适用于Windows,除非您安装了Cygwin并且可以运行make

    提示:使用wsdl2h选项-v查看其(详细)输出。